Product-line review: revenue 100,000, COGS 64,000
A product line brings in $100,000 of revenue and its cost of goods sold is $64,000. Gross profit is 100,000 − 64,000 = $36,000. The gross margin is 36,000 / 100,000 = 36%. If the business wants $50,000 of gross profit at a 36% margin, it needs revenue of about $138,889.
